GUI for Windows tweaks.
Tweaks are defined by INI files stored in a category folder (including its subfolders) in the Tweaky folder next to the executable.
Example file structure:
Tweaky.exe
Tweaky/
[Category]/
[Tweak].ini
[Subcategory]/
[Tweak].ini
Tweak files consist of 3 sections:
Info
Makes a tweak recognizable in the UI.
[Info]
Name=My amazing tweak
Description=Disables an annoying feature.
Toggle
Defines commands to be executed on toggle.
Before toggling:
{}
will be replaced with the absolute path to the script directory.- Environment variable
TWEAKY
with value0
or1
indicating new state will be set for the started process.
[Toggle]
Enable=enable.bat
Disable=disabe.bat
Status
Defines the tweak's status in the UI.
The command's output (output
) or exit code (code
) will be checked against the provided Regex value. If there is a match the tweak will be considered enabled. If the section is not present the tweak will be treated not toggleable and can only be enabled.
[Status]
Command=status.bat
Type=output
Value=(success|ok)
